Nayeema Firdous Borbhuyan secures 10th in HSLC 2018

Nayeema Firdous Borbhuyan Of Nilbagan Jatiya Vidaylay in Hojai district has secured tenth rank in the High School Leaving Certificate (HSLC) 2018 examination the results of which have been announced on Friday.

Nayeema is the daughter of Anam Uddin Borbhuyan and Habibaa Begum resident of Nilbagan.

Nayeema has secured 584 marks out of 600 and letters in all the subjects.

Talking to Media, Nayeema said she had studied with consistency for 8 to 9 hours daily. She will pursue her further study in Science stream at Ramanju College in Nagaon. 

She wants to become a good Doctor and work for the welfare of the society.

It is to be mentioned Nayeema has only secured a rank in entire Hojai District. She had brought laurels for her  school as well entire Hojai.


On the other hand, Jebin Kausar a "Divyang" who belongs to poor family and  Student of Gyan Jyoti Academy of Murajhar in Hojai District has proved that,"If You have a Burning Desire to Do Something then no obstacles can halt you back."

Jebin wrote  High School Leaving Certificate (HSLC), 2018 examination  with her feet  secured first division marks and has set an example for others.

According to Jebin  if one has strong determination to do something, then no hurdle can stop you to achieve anything.

She says her dream is to be a Good Teacher in future and work for the upliftment of the society.

HOJAI: In a bid to bust the spreading illicit liquor trade, the Hojai police have launched a major crackdown that has been successful in firmly dealing with the illegal traders in many pockets of the district.A police team launched a sudden raid against the illicit country liquor trade on Saturday night forcing many people dealing in it in the town to flee from the spot.Led by additional SP Anita Nath and assisted by Hojai police station officer in charge Kiteswar Baniya, the police team  further seized 500 litre illicit liquor and foreign liquor from Lalpatty area in the town during the raid.

HOJAI:"Gangaur" the  18 days festival concluded on  Tuesday  with the immersion of statue' s of  Lord Shiva and Parvati at Shivbari Ghat in Hojai. This Puja is mainly done by the newly married bride and young girls. Talking to Assam Times, Sushila Rathi said," Young girls and newly married bride mainly celebrates this festival  to appease Lord Shiv and Parvati and take their blessings for their happy married life." At Shivbari ghat after the immersion the ladies and girls were seen smearing colours to each other.
